sturgeon plural

stur·geon

The plural form of sturgeon is sturgeon

S s

Definitions

  • noun plural sturgeon any of various large fishes of the family Acipenseridae, inhabiting fresh and salt North Temperate waters, valued for their flesh and as a source of caviar and isinglass: A. brevirostrum, of the Atlantic coast, is endangered. 1
